Abstract
Nowadays, the stock price prediction has been one of the most challenging problem to the AI research community. Most prediction techniques concentrate on forecasting the future prices of stocks based on conventional Machine learning techniques. However, these techniques cannot capture long term dependencies in stock price data. Therefore, they cannot consider the relation between the current predicted data and the previous data in stock data. This research adopts deep learning techniques for predicting buy and sell recommendations in Stock Exchange of Thailand using Long Short-Term Memory. The proposed model can capture long term dependencies in stock price data in order to enhance the prediction accuracy. The accuracy of the proposed model is evaluated on five Stock Exchange of Thailand (SET) stocks, between 5 January 2015 and 29 December 2017, and compared the results with support vector Machine, multilayer perceptron, decision tree, random forest, logistic regression and k-nearest neighbors. The experimental results signify that the proposed model can outperform all comparative models.
